BENGKULU - The Bengkulu High Prosecutor's Special Crime Investigation Team (Pidsus) said five suspects in the corruption case of mining production and exploration belonging to PT Ratu Samban Mining and PT Tunas Bara Jaya were suspected of having added to the protected forest area.
The five suspects, who are also coal mining entrepreneurs in Bengkulu Province, also sold coal illegally or illegally in accordance with applicable regulations.
"We are dealing with acts against the law or abusing finances, causing state losses. The characters are different from general criminal mining laws. One of the roles of these five suspects is the untrueity before buying and selling, meaning that the acquisition is invalid so we have calculated at the beginning we concluded, because it was not the goods then sold," said Head of the Investigation Section of the Bengkulu Attorney General's Office, Danang Prasetyo, quoted by Antara, Thursday, July 24.
He explained that the mining business license (IUP) of PT Ratu Samban Mining (RSM) had been problematic since 2011, while the findings of irregularities in coal sales were carried out from 2021 to 2022.
"The state's losses in this case reached more than Rp500 billion, more than the total damage caused by the environment and its main causes the untrueities that occurred during coal mining and during coal sales," said Danang.
Previously, investigators from the Bengkulu Special Prosecutor's Office named five coal mining entrepreneurs in Bengkulu Province as suspects in the alleged corruption case in the production and exploration of mining belonging to PT Ratu Samban Mining and PT Tunas Bara Jaya.
The five suspects are Tunas Bara Jaya Commissioner Bebby Hussy, General Manager of PT Inti Bara Perdana Saskya Hussy, President Director of Tunas Bara Jaya Julius Soh, Marketing of PT Inti Bara Perdana Agusman, Director of Tunas Bara Jaya Sutarman.
"Today we have named a suspect in the Mining Corruption case after we find an unlawful act and a series of witness examinations, we will determine the suspects," said Head of the Legal Information Section of the Bengkulu Attorney General's Office, Ristianti Andriani.

The five suspects were detained in three different locations, namely the Malabero Detention Center Bengkulu City for suspects Bebby Hussy, Bentiling Class II A Correctional Institution (Lapas) Bengkulu City, namely Saskya Hussy and Sutarman.
Meanwhile, the suspects Julius Soh and Agusman were detained while in Arga Makmur Prison, North Bengkulu Regency, Bengkulu Province.
